The Proverbs 31 Woman

She gets up while it is still dark; she provides food for her family. . . . Her lamp does not go out at night.
Proverbs 31:15, 18 NIV

The Proverbs 31 woman puts Wonder Woman to shame. Up before dawn, late to bed, caring for her household, negotiating business contracts down at the city gate. She gives to the poor, plans for her household to run smoothly, anticipates future needs, such as snowy weather. Even her arms are buff! “She sets about her work vigorously; her arms are strong for her tasks” (Proverbs 31:17 NIV).

She is highly energetic, an efficiency expert, and gifted in relationships. “Her children arise and call her blessed; her husband also, and he praises her” (v. 28). This woman is downright intimidating!

So how do we benefit by reading about the Proverbs 31 woman? Reading about her day makes us feel overwhelmed, discouraged by our inadequacies. That bar is too high!

But God doesn’t place the bar so high that we live in its shadow. He wired each of us with different gifts, different energy levels, different responsibilities. Proverbs 31 casts a floodlight on all women—those gifted in business, in home life, as caregivers. This chapter displays how women undergird their families and their communities.

Remember, the book of Proverbs was written in the tenth century BC, when women were considered chattel. But not in God’s eyes. He has always esteemed women and the many roles we fulfill in society.
